Technical Summary
The Inventec Calcutta 10AD is an AMD Danube (Champlain) platform motherboard featuring an RS880M GPU and SB820M southbridge. The system utilizes two DDR3 SODIMM slots for memory expansion. Power management is handled by a MAX17435 charger architecture with a MAX17480 voltage regulator, alongside TPS51217, TPS51218, TPS51125, G5694F11U, and G916T1U power ICs. The embedded controller is an ITE W781L, and the BIOS SPI flash is supplied by Winbond. Audio is managed by a Conexant CX20671 codec, while networking is provided by an Atheros AR8152 LAN controller and an Atheros WLAN module. Additional I/O includes a Genesys card reader and a USB3638 USB hub controller.
